A13 FNK is a 2006 Mercedes-benz B-class in Blue with a 2,034c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 23 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 69.6%.
Across all 2006 Mercedes-benz B-class models, the average MOT pass rate is 74.8% with a typical mileage of 69,513 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Mercedes-benz B-class f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 6,159 recorded failures. If you're considering buying A13 FNK,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Mercedes-benz B-class typically stays on UK roads for around 21 years. At 20 years old, this Mercedes-benz B-class is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
